Subject: [Buildroot] Buildroot 2022.08-rc1 released

This time around, 1089 commits from 110 different contributors since
2022.05, with a spike of activity during the recent Buildroot hackathon
organized end of July.

Of noteworthy new features/changes we have:

	Architecture

	- Support for NDS32 removed
	- Support for C-SKY removed
	- Support for configurable page size on ARM64 added
	- Architecture menu re-organized: the MMU selection now
	  appears in this architecture menu.

	Toolchain:

	- GCC 12.x support added, GCC 11.x is now the default
	  compiler, and support for building a GCC 9.x toolchain has
	  been removed.
	- glibc bumped to 2.35-134-gb6aade18a7e5719c942aa2da6cf3157aca993fa4
	- uclibc bumped to 1.0.42
	- BR2_GCC_ENABLE_LTO option removed, the toolchain is now
	  always built with LTO support. The new option BR2_ENABLE_LTO
	  enables the use of LTO in a subset of packages that have
	  explicit handling for LTO.
	- GDB enabled on OpenRISC.
	- Toolchain menu now appears before "Build options". The
	  selection of the C library now determines whether static
	  library (BR2_STATIC_LIBS) will be available or not, instead
	  of the other way around.

	Filesystem:

	- genimage.cfg files now use shortcuts from genimage for the
	  GUID of well-known GPT partitions.

	Bootloaders:

	- U-Boot can now be built with host-gnutls as a dependency,
	  needed for some configurations
	- OP-TEE can now be built with host-python-pillow as a
	  dependency, needed for some configurations.
	- OP-TEE source can now be retrieved from a custom tarball
	  URL.
	- Grub has been bumped to 2.06.

	Over 390 packages updated.

We will now create a next branch and start merging new features for
2022.11 already in parallel with the 2022.08 stabilization.
